Peter, seeking anonymity, reflects a growing trend of individuals using AI chatbots as “trip sitters” for support during psychedelic experiences. This practice merges two cultural movements: the use of AI for mental health therapy and the rising interest in psychedelics for alleviating conditions like depression and PTSD. Although cheaper than traditional therapy, experts warn that relying on AI for such delicate situations can be dangerous. Many people have turned to chatbots for guidance due to the high costs and stigma associated with professional counseling. AI figures, like Ilya Sutskever, envision a future where AI therapy is widely accessible. However, while some users report beneficial experiences with AI companionship during trips, experts caution against substituting human therapists with unregulated chatbots. Effective therapy involves nuanced understanding and presence, which AI lacks, making this blend of AI and psychedelics a risky psychological choice.
